This maritime impact on 3 sides in the area tempers extremes of temperature, developing moderate wet winters and heat dry summers.

From the primary commercial winery planting in Margaret River in 1967, the region’s natural assets have blended with the flexibility of your vignerons and winemakers to produce a wine area that's one of the best on the planet.

, Bay along with other oceanic references are very common in Margaret River wine names. A single particularly clever community wine is named Girt-by-Sea – a reference each to your peninsula's three coasts and to a line in Australia's countrywide anthem: "We have golden soil and wealth for toil, our house is girt by sea".

Find parcels were being entire bunch fermented to stimulate partial carbonic maceration and introduce vibrant, spicy strawberry fruit character. The wines had been inoculated for MLF, pressed off and then transferred into used French oak puncheons and barrels. Following nine months in oak the batches have been blended, egg white fined and after that bottled.

The fruit is picked by hand and dealt with with terrific treatment in little batches. Destemming varies from 70% to complete as well as crushing is light on the way to a mix of open and closed fermenters. The ferments are guide in a web link mix of wild and chosen yeasts and operations are made a decision day by day without recipe to improve prospective and complexity.
